Oracle RAC发展之路崭新的局面(oracle rac发展)
在Oracle RAC的发展历程中,近年来出现了一些崭新的局面。随着云时代的到来,Oracle RAC也逐渐适应了云计算模式,并在可靠性、可伸缩性、可用性等方面都得到了极大的提升。
一、Oracle RAC的基础
Oracle RAC是一种数据库技术,它是Oracle集群数据库的核心组件。Oracle RAC可以运行在多个节点上,实现数据库的共享。通过将数据库分布在多个节点上,Oracle RAC可以提高系统的可靠性、可伸缩性和可用性等方面的性能。
二、Oracle RAC的发展历程
Oracle RAC最早在2001年提出,经历了多个版本的发展。其中,Oracle RAC 10g是Oracle RAC的一个里程碑式版本,它引入了共享存储区域(Clustered Shared Volume),实现了高可用性的共享存储。随着10g版本的发布,Oracle RAC开始流行起来,被越来越多的企业所采用。
在之后的版本中,Oracle RAC逐渐适应了云计算时代的发展,实现了更高的可靠性、可伸缩性和可用性等方面的性能。例如,在11g版本中,Oracle RAC引入了自动存储管理(ASM)技术,优化了存储管理的效率。在12c版本中,Oracle RAC引入了强一致性的缓存(In-Memory Cache),实现了更高的性能和可伸缩性。
三、Oracle RAC的云化之路
随着云时代的到来,Oracle RAC也逐渐适应了云计算模式,并在可靠性、可伸缩性、可用性等方面都得到了极大的提升。例如,在云环境下,Oracle RAC能够自动进行节点扩缩容,根据实例的负载情况自动增加或减少节点数量,实现了更高的可伸缩性。另外,在云环境下,Oracle RAC还支持多租户技术,多个用户可以在同一台物理服务器上共享Oracle RAC实例。
此外,Oracle RAC在云环境下还支持数据管理的自动化。通过Oracle RAC的自动化管理功能,管理员可以通过Web界面来操作数据库,从而实现对数据库的自动化管理和监控。管理员可以监视数据库的性能、容量和可用性等指标,进行容量规划和故障处理等工作。
四、Oracle RAC的发展前景
随着云计算模式的广泛应用,Oracle RAC在云环境下的应用也将不断扩展。未来,Oracle RAC将继续致力于提高数据库的性能、可伸缩性、可用性等方面的性能,并且在安全性和稳定性等方面也将得到进一步的提升。
Oracle RAC在数据库技术的发展历程中发挥着重要的作用,其在云环境下的应用也得到了极大的推广和应用。我们可以期待,在不久的将来,Oracle RAC将继续发展壮大,为企业带来更高效、更可靠的数据库服务。